Overview

Postcode M5 4HE is located in a major urban area, within the Pendleton & Charlestown ward of Salford in the North West region, and forms part of the Ordsall West area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 91.0 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Ordsall West is £37,636 per year. The nearest station is Salford Crescent located about 0.9 miles away. There are 7 primary and 3 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, closest medium park is Clarendon Park.
